Highbrook War Memorial is a Grade II listed building-listed memorial in england-south-east, United Kingdom, registered on the National Heritage List for England (NHLE entry 1439522). Listed status protects buildings and structures of special architectural or historic interest. See the linked Wikipedia article for further details.
